I have been corresponding with someone on the diabetes LIST about food
labels and this morning she wrote the following:

>There were none at all many years ago when I first started working with Esther
>Peterson on the project. Diabetes has had a great role in food labeling. We
>complained mightily about not knowing that canned carrots and corned beef,
>etc were packed with sugar. It's amazing what we worker bees can accomplish
>in a good cause. Or my favorite line , "There is no end to what can be
>accomplished, if it doesn't matter who gets the credit. "

So, folks, don't despair,  We can eventually make something happen with
labels, but it won't be tomorrow...
